Risk Management - Overview
Overview Considerations Matrix Instructions Hot Topics Contact Us

 

Risk Management is a process whereby an attempt is made to identify, evaluate and control loss exposures to minimize the adverse effects of unpredictable events. It involves:

Identification of Potential Risks
Evaluation of Risks
-- Probability
-- Consequences
The Management of Risks
-- Risks to be eliminated
-- Risks to be limited
-- Risks to be accepted

UNLV believes the process of risk management should be to reduce and manage risks while maintaining student leadership development through experiential learning.

The goals of Proactive Risk Management guidelines are to ensure event planners plan and host events where everyone involved has a safe and fun experience. Risk Management involves determining potential and perceived risks involved in activities, as well as supervising organization activities and taking corrective actions and proactive steps to minimize accidental injury and/or loss. In order for events to remain a positive part of the UNLV experience, it is important planners take precautions and carefully plan their activities so they can avoid situations that may jeopardize the safety and well-being of the UNLV campus community.
